Jo'burg Test: India win toss, elect to bat first against South Africa
Johannesburg, Jan 24 (IBNS): Indian captain Virat Kohli won the toss and elected to bat first against South Africa in the third Test match in Johannesburg on Wednesday.
India have made couple of changes in the team. Ajinkya Rahane is playing for Rohit Sharma and Bhuvneshwar Kumar is replacing Ravichandran Ashwin.
India are going with a full pace bowling line up in the match.
